Children are generally entitled to maintenance payments until they have completed their vocational training. These maintenance payments are to be made primarily by the parents. In exceptional cases, the grandparents may also be required to provide maintenance.

If a parent looks after a minor child, they do not usually owe any cash maintenance. Rather, they fulfill their maintenance obligation by providing care and support for their child, providing a place to live, food, clothing, etc.. The non-custodial parent, on the other hand, owes cash maintenance. The amount of maintenance depends, among other things, on his income, the age of the child and other maintenance obligations. From the time the child comes of age, both parents are required to pay cash maintenance in accordance with the amount of their respective incomes.

Lawyers, authorities and courts use tables and guidelines created by the higher regional courts that are regularly updated to determine the specific amount of the maintenance obligation. The Dusseldorf table is particularly important here.

Only part of the income is relevant for the maintenance calculation. Income tax or wage tax, church tax, and contributions to pension funds for illness, long-term care, old age, disability and unemployment are to be deducted from the gross income. Other items that may be deducted include work-related expenses, such as travel costs from home to work, and debts that need to be taken into account. According to the highest court in the land, the extent to which liabilities are to be taken into account can only be decided at the court's discretion after a comprehensive balancing of interests.

For example, the Federal Court of Justice ruled in March 2022 that, in principle, the repayment installments that the person liable for maintenance makes on a loan to finance his or her own home can also be taken into account, in addition to interest payments, up to the amount of the housing benefit, even in the case of child support.
